King Willem-Alexander of the Netherlands attends programme of Nieuwe Instituut at World Expo in Japan

Nieuwe Instituut is curator of the cultural programme of the Dutch Pavilion at the World Expo in Osaka, Kansai, Japan.

21 May 2025

  • On Wednesday 21 May, His Majesty King Willem-Alexander was a guest at the Dutch National Day at the World Expo in Osaka, Kansai, Japan.

  • At the World Expo, His Majesty attended part of Activating Common Ground, the cultural programme that the Nieuwe Instituut curated for the Dutch Pavilion.

  • The cultural programme was set up as an interdisciplinary “live magazine”, in which collaboration and exchange between Japanese and Dutch makers are central throughout.

  • The King visited the dance performance UNUM by Introdans and Land Fes and opened the exhibition Bridging Past & Future, which shows the result of collaborations between Dutch and Japanese makers.

  • The cultural programme takes place in the Dutch pavilion and other locations in Osaka during the six-month duration of the World Expo.
